2011 NHL Quarterfinals round - Series 1132. Nashville Predators vs Vancouver Canucks
Schedule and 2010-11 Results 
Regular Season Records: Vancouver 54-19-9=117pts, Nashville 44-27-11=99pts 
Game 1 on Thursday, 28 April: Nashville loses at Vancouver, 1-goal-nil 
Game 2 on Saturday, 30 April: Nashville wins at Vancouver, 2-goals-1 (2OT) 
Game 3 on Tuesday, 03 May: Vancouver wins at Nashville, 3-goals-2 (OT) 
Game 4 on Thursday, 05 May: Vancouver wins at Nashville, 4-goals-2 
Game 5 on Saturday, 07 May: Nashville wins at Vancouver, 4-goals-3 
Game 6 on Monday, 09 May: Vancouver wins at Nashville, 2-goals-1 
SERIES NOTES:
  
Post-series assessment: The Vancouver Canucks defeated the Nashville Predators 4-games-2 in MLB/NBA/NHL best-of-7 playoff series 1132. With the series 1132 victory, the Vancouver Canucks improve their best-of-7 NHL playoff series record to 14-16 overall and 3-8 in the Quarterfinals. With the series 1132 loss, the Nashville Predators' best-of-7 NHL playoff series record falls to 1-6 overall and 0-1 in the Quarterfinals. The series 1132 win order for the victorious Vancouver Canucks was WLWWLW: Series 1132 thus becomes the fourth NHL Quarterfinals series, the 16th NHL series (all rounds), and the 41st MLB/NBA/NHL series (all rounds) to follow that win order to completion. In series 1132 Game 2, the visiting Nashville Predators scored to tie the Vancouver Canucks with but 67 seconds left in regulation. In the history of best-of-7 NHL playoff games, from 1939 through 2010, inclusive, road teams trailing by a goal with only 68 seconds left in regulation had a game record of 17-502 (.033). By the time that Nashville won the game with a goal 14:51 into the second overtime, the historical victory probabilities were decidedly in the visitors' favor: In the history of best-of-7 NHL playoff games, from 1939 through 2010, inclusive, road teams at 14:50 into the second overtime had a game record of 26-15 (.634).
  
Pre-series assessment: In the 2010-11 regular season, Vancouver finished 18 points ahead of Nashville. From 1939 through the 2011 NHL Preliminary round, when NHL teams led their best-of-7 playoff series opponents by 18 regular-season points, they have posted a 10-6 (.625) best-of-7 NHL playoff series record in those series against those opponents (with an active five-series winning streak). MLB/NBA/NHL best-of-7 playoff series 1132 is the seventh best-of-7 playoff series for Nashville, and the 30th for Vancouver. In best-of-7 playoff series, Nashville has a 1-5 series record, a 0-0 Quarterfinals-round series record, and a 3-3 Game 1 record, while Vancouver has a 13-16 series record, a 2-8 Quarterfinals-round record with an active five Quarterfinals-series losing streak, and an 18-11 Game 1 record. Series 1132 is the first best-of-7 NHL playoff series meeting between Nashville and Vancouver.
